summaryrefslogtreecommitdiff
diff options
context:
space:
mode:
author Xiangyu/Malcolm Chen <refuhoo@google.com> 2020-04-03 00:43:30 +0000
committer Android (Google) Code Review <android-gerrit@google.com> 2020-04-03 00:43:30 +0000
commite025fcef40747e94f1d5e69a61a3e4f43c6abdf7 (patch)
tree026a752360301e873086e0eae4055759af279201
parent8ad7c0ec42789667cd0d9945feadaf275824b9d3 (diff)
parentba874c682787cc198899c576abb52d33ab43309e (diff)
Merge "multiSimAllowed should be consistent with max active modem property." into rvc-dev
-rw-r--r--telephony/java/android/telephony/TelephonyManager.java3
1 files changed, 3 insertions, 0 deletions
diff --git a/telephony/java/android/telephony/TelephonyManager.java b/telephony/java/android/telephony/TelephonyManager.java
index 4e5be5c453b7..9ae905df8776 100644
--- a/telephony/java/android/telephony/TelephonyManager.java
+++ b/telephony/java/android/telephony/TelephonyManager.java
@@ -12344,6 +12344,9 @@ public class TelephonyManager {
@RequiresPermission(android.Manifest.permission.READ_PHONE_STATE)
@IsMultiSimSupportedResult
public int isMultiSimSupported() {
+ if (getSupportedModemCount() < 2) {
+ return TelephonyManager.MULTISIM_NOT_SUPPORTED_BY_HARDWARE;
+ }
try {
ITelephony service = getITelephony();
if (service != null) {